Kings of Macedon. Alexander III "the Great". AR, Drachm. 4.16 g. - 116.81 mm. 336-323 BC. Lifetime issue of Miletus, struck under Philoxenos, circa 325-323.
Obv.: Head of Herakles to right, wearing lion skin headdress.
Rev.: ΑΛΕΞΑΝΔΡΟΥ, Zeus Aëtophoros seated left on backless throne, right leg drawn back, feet suspended, eagle in outstretched right hand, grounded scepter in left; thunderbolt in left field; HΔ monogram below strut.
Ref.: Price 2088.
